Thought I would share a quote from "White Fire" by Preston an Child that I ran across.
"Carroting, you must understand, was a process by which animal fur is bathed in a solution of mercury nitrate, in order to render the hairs more supple, thus producing a superior felt." At this last word, he threw a significant glance in my direction.
"Felt," I repeated. "You mean for the making of hats?"
"Precisely. The solution is of an orange color, hence the term "Carroting". However, this process had rather severe side effects on those who worked with it, which is why its use today is much reduced. When mercury vapors are inhaled over a long enough period of time the toxic and irreversible effects almost inevitably follow. One develops tremors of the hands, blackened teeth:slurred speech.. In severe cases, dementia or outright insanity can occur. Hence the term " mad as a hatter"
